  • In this video I show you how to make a bar of soap using activated charcoal! I am remaking a soap that has sold out several times called Blackwood in this video, but the same rules should apply if you wanted to make a tea tree soap or any other scent. Activated charcoal is known for helping to draw out impurities and is ideal for facial soaps. Making an activated charcoal soap is surprisingly simple to do, you just need to make sure you are careful when you use activated charcoal to not inhale it. Wearing a mask is always recommended when working with it!

    Hi Nathan, when I mix AC with oil in a cup, I pour that into my soap at emulsion, then pour a bit of soap into the cup and use a small spatula to scrape it out and back into the soap base. I do this 2 or 3 times (only takes a few seconds), then wipe the cup out with paper towel and pop it into the sink. No messy charcoal oil in the sink then. Also, mixing the charcoal in oil the day before seems to bring out the black more.
